Bug ID: 60450 Summary: Setting keystore type shouldn't override the truststore type Product: Tomcat 8 Version: 8.5.x-trunk Hardware: PC Status: NEW Severity: normal Priority: P2 Component: Util Assignee: dev@tomcat.apache.org Reporter: a...@boxfuse.com Target Milestone: ---- Say I have a keystore in PKCS12 format and a truststore in the default JKS format. By setting the keystore type (PKCS12) and NOT explicitly overriding the default truststore type (JKS), the truststore type now also gets changed to PKCS12 and fails to load. This line is the issue: https://github.com/apache/tomcat/blob/trunk/java/org/apache/tomcat/util/net/SSLHostConfig.java#L585 This behavior is currently very unintuitive and not documented anywhere.
